Welcome to this charming single-story home featuring 4-5 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ms, including a spacious 238sqft garage conversion (not reflected on HCAD). Enjoy outdoor living with a covered patio and beautifully maintained landscaping. The interior offers laminate and tile flooring throughout—no carpet! The remodeled primary bathroom boasts a large walk-in shower, expansive countertop space, and generous closets. With a recently replaced AC and a roof just 6 years old, this home is move-in ready with all appliances.
